"Hibernate Tools - How to handle updates to one-to-many property" To view the discussion, visit: http://community.jboss.org/message/573982#573982 -------------------------------------------------------------- Hi, I am using the JBoss Hibernate plug in for eclipse and attempting to reverse engineer my pojos from a mysql database. I have been able to do this with some success and i do see that the one-to-many and many-to-many properties are definied in the hbm files. What is happening however, is if i have pojo that represents a one to many relationship, and i make changes to both tables, only the single 'one' table is updated. For example, let's say i have a Person and a PersonAddress table that contain foreign key relationships. When i reverse engineer the Pojos from this database, what is created is a Person pojo which also contains a Set of PersonAddress: public Set<PersonAddress> getPersonAddresses() { return this.personAddresses; } public void setPersonAddresses(Set<PersonAddress> personAddresses) { this.personAddresses = personAddresses; } public void setPersonAddresses(Set<PersonAddress> personAddresses) { this.personAddresses = personAddresses; } If i update the Person.name and use hibernate to save that change, all works well. If i update the name and also add a new address however, the name changes, but the address is not added to the PersonAddress table.
